Mountain bike suspension upgrade: what changes?
A mountain bike suspension upgrade typically aims at better traction, control, and reduced fatigue. Riders often notice the biggest improvements when a stock fork or shock feels harsh over small bumps, dives too much under braking, or bottoms out on bigger hits. Before buying parts, it helps to set expectations: a higher-quality fork can track the ground better and offer more tuning (air pressure, rebound, compression), but it will not compensate for incorrect sag, worn pivot bearings, or underpowered brakes.
Compatibility is where many upgrades succeed or fail. Check wheel size, steerer type (straight vs. tapered), axle standard (quick release, 15x100, 15x110 Boost), and brake mount style. Travel matters too: adding more travel than the frame is designed for can change geometry and stress the bike. If you’re unsure, compare your current fork’s axle-to-crown measurement and the frame maker’s allowed travel range. For many riders, spending time dialing in sag and rebound first can reveal whether you need a new unit or simply better setup and fresh service.
Electric commuter bicycle deals: how to compare value?
“Electric commuter bicycle deals” are easier to evaluate when you compare the full package, not just the headline discount. In the U.S., commuter-oriented e-bikes vary by motor type (hub-drive vs. mid-drive), battery capacity (often measured in watt-hours), included accessories (lights, fenders, rack), and service support. A lower-priced bike can be a good fit if it meets your range needs and you have a realistic plan for maintenance, replacement parts, and battery care.
Pay attention to the items that drive day-to-day usability: tire size and puncture resistance, integrated lighting, stable racks, and weather protection. Also consider where service will come from. Some brands sell primarily direct-to-consumer, while others rely on dealer networks; either can work, but the ownership experience differs. Finally, align the bike’s assisted speed class and local rules with where you’ll ride, especially if your commute includes multi-use paths or dense urban traffic.
Real-world pricing tends to cluster in broad bands. Many entry-level commuter e-bikes land around the low-to-mid four figures, while mid-drive systems, integrated batteries, and premium components push costs higher. Budget for essentials that are easy to overlook: a quality lock, a helmet, lights if not included, and periodic maintenance (tires, brake pads, chain/cassette wear). If you’re comparing “deal” pricing, also consider warranty terms, local shop labor rates, and whether the brand has reliable access to replacement batteries and proprietary parts.

Children’s cycling safety gear: what matters?
For children’s cycling safety gear, fit and correct use matter as much as the product category. Start with a helmet that meets U.S. safety standards (commonly CPSC for bicycle helmets) and fits snugly without pressure points. The helmet should sit level, low on the forehead, with the straps forming a secure “V” around the ears and minimal movement when the child shakes their head. Replacing helmets after a significant impact and avoiding secondhand helmets with unknown history are practical safety habits.
Visibility and comfort help kids actually keep gear on. Bright colors, reflective elements, and reliable front/rear lights (especially for dusk or neighborhood streets) can reduce the chance of a driver missing a small rider. Gloves can improve grip and protect hands in a fall, while knee and elbow pads are often worthwhile for new riders or skate-park style riding. Also consider bike fit and control: appropriately sized bikes, working brakes sized for small hands, and tires with adequate tread can prevent many common falls.
